Reach for Pantry Staples

There’s no single definition of the Mediterranean Diet, but it’s high in vegetables, fruits, whole grains, nuts, seeds, olive oil and seafood. By keeping your pantry stocked with canned versions of ingredients like beans and fish you can easily add them to your favorite dishes.

Add Seafood.

Eating more seafood is one of the leading principles of the Mediterranean Diet. Tuna salad is one tried-and-true dish that can help incorporate fish into your menu. To make it more nutritious, opt for tuna that’s packed in extra-virgin olive oil, so you don’t have to add much mayo to the base. Yellowfin Tuna Pasta Salad with Arugula Pesto and Dates

    Prep Time: 20-30 minutes

    Cook time: 20-25 minute

    Servings: 4

Yellowfin Tuna Pasta Salad with Arugula Pesto and Dates Ingredients

    2 cans (5 ounces each) Genova Yellowfin Tuna in Olive Oil, drained

    1/2 cup pine nuts

    4 cups arugula

    1 garlic clove

    2 tablespoons butter (optional)

    1 cup grated Parmigiano-Reggiano, plus additional for garnish (optional)

    2 lemons, zest only (optional)

    1/2 teaspoon kosher salt

    1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per

    3/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il

    8 ounces whole-wheat orecchiette

    1/2 cup jarred sun-dried tomatoes in oil, chopped

    1/2 cup dates, pitted and quartered

    1/4 cup kalamata olives, pitted and chopped

    1/4 cup dill, chopped (optional)

    1/4 cup parsley, chopped (optional)

Yellowfin Tuna Pasta Salad with Arugula Pesto and Dates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 325 F.
  • On a sheet tray, toast pine nuts 8-12 minutes, or until golden. Set aside to cool.
  • Bring large pot of salted water to boil. Prepare ice water bath by filling large bowl with cold water and ice. Stir arugula into boiling water and cook until bright green and tender, about 30 seconds. Drain arugula, immediately shock in ice water and set aside to fully drain; cover with towel.
  • In blender or food processor, add arugula; garlic; pine nuts; butter, if desired; Parmigiano-Reggiano; lemon zest, if desired; salt; and pepper. Puree on high, incorporating olive oil to desired thickness.
  • Place pesto in bowl and cover tightly to avoid discoloring.
  • Bring large pot of salted water to boil.
  • Add pasta and return to boil, stirring occasionally. Taste pasta for doneness 2 minutes earlier than package instructions. Once cooked, drain and transfer to large bowl. Do not rinse.
  • Add pesto gently until evenly distributed. Fold in tuna, sun-dried tomatoes, dates and olives.
  • Divide between shallow bowls and finish with additional Parmigiano-Reggiano, dill and parsley, if desired.
